Do you have any photos of how people have styled multiple urban planter boxes together?

Absolutely, I’d be happy to share some visual inspiration for styling multiple urban planter boxes together. While I can’t display actual photographs, I can describe popular arrangements that people have used, which you can easily imagine or recreate.

One common approach is the layered height technique. Place taller planter boxes at the back or corners, medium-sized ones in the middle, and shorter, trailing plants at the front. This creates a natural, tiered garden look that maximizes space and visual depth.

Another stylish method is color coordination through plant selection. For example, grouping boxes with monochromatic foliage (like all shades of green) or complementary bloom colors (such as purple and yellow) can unify a set of planters into a cohesive design.

For balcony or patio railings, people often attach narrow planter boxes in a row, filling them with cascading plants like ivy or petunias. This creates a lush, uniform border that softens hard edges.

You might also see clustered arrangements on the ground—three or four square or rectangular boxes placed at slightly different angles around a seating area. This adds structure and frames the space naturally.

Finally, vertical stacking is popular for small urban spaces. Using tiered stands or shelves, people place multiple boxes at different heights against a wall, turning a blank surface into a living plant wall.
